Product Overview
The PBRC20.00HR50X000 is a 7.4 x 3.4mm 50ppm surface-mount small and low profile ceramic Chip Resonator features high reliability, high temperature withstanding ceramic case, rectangular shape allows easy pick and placement. The PBRC-H series resonator with nickel barrier + Au flashes terminations and it is reflow solderable.
- Excellent solderability
Applications
Clock & Timing, Consumer Electronics
